S32.122B
ICD-10-CMSeverely displaced Zone II fracture of sacrum, initial encounter for open fracture
This code signifies a severe break in the middle section of the sacrum (Zone II), where the bone fragments are significantly out of alignment. This particular injury involves an open wound, meaning the skin and soft tissues are compromised, exposing the fracture site.
Apply this code for initial treatment of a patient presenting with a traumatic sacral fracture that is clearly documented as severely displaced and involves an open wound. This is typically seen in high-impact trauma cases where the force of injury has caused both significant bone displacement and a breach of the skin.
